    Under the the hyperboundedness-like conditions (I) [by \textit{L. Gross}, in J. Funct. Anal. 10, 52-109 (1972; Zbl 0237.47012)], the existence of invariant measures for given Markovian (or positive preserving) semigroups (including the infinite-dimensional cases) are proved. In order to consider the exponential dacay of the Markov semigroup \((P_t)\) in infinite dimension to a project operator, an ergodic condition (E) [given by \textit{S. Kusuoka}, ibid. 103, No. 2, 229-274 (1992; Zbl 0772.58003)] is introduced as a substitution for the strict positivity of transition densities. It is proved that \((P_t)\) is exponential dacay to a project operator in \(L_p\) sense iff conditions (I) and (E) hold.
